"Notch" is a word in ENGLISH

notch ENGLISH
Definition:

To cut or make notches in ; to indent; also, to score by
notches; as, to notch a stick.

notch ENGLISH
Definition:

To fit the notch of (an arrow) to the string.

notch ENGLISH
Definition:

A narrow passage between two elevation; a deep, close pass;
a defile; as, the notch of a mountain.

notch ENGLISH
Definition:

A hollow cut in anything; a nick; an indentation.
